The contention of the petitioner is that he is having 63% orthopedic (locomotor) disability. Due to inaction of the respondents in deciding the legitimate claim of the petitioner for notional promotion to the post of Extension Officer (Education) with retrospective effect from 30/06/2016, the present petition is filed.
4.
The learned counsel for the petitioner relied on the GR KHUNTE
24-wp3908.26.odt 2/2 dated 29/07/2024. Despite multiple representations, the claim of the petitioner has not decided. The only relief claimed in the petition is for directing the respondent No.2Chief Executive Officer, Zilla Parishad, Yavatmal and respondent No.3-Education Officer (Primary), Zilla Parishad Yavatmal to decide the representation dated 20/05/2025 within a stipulated time. In view of this limited prayer, we are of the considered opinion that the petition can be disposed of. Accordingly, the petition is allowed. 5.
The respondent No.2-Chief Executive Officer, Zilla Parishad, Yavatmal and respondent No.3-Education Officer (Primary), Zilla Parishad Yavatmal are directed to decide the pending representation dated 20/05/2025 within a period of four weeks, specifically in the light of GR dated 29/07/2024. 6.
The petitioner to appear before the respondent No.2Chief Executive Officer, Zilla Parishad, Yavatmal and respondent No.3-Education Officer (Primary), Zilla Parishad Yavatmal on 18/05/2026 at 11.00 am.
7.
The respondent No.2-Chief Executive Officer, Zilla Parishad, Yavatmal and respondent No.3-Education Officer (Primary), Zilla Parishad Yavatmal to decide the representation dated 20/05/2025 after granting due opportunity of hearing to the petitioner within a period of four weeks.
8.
The petition stands disposed of. No costs.
